     45  1.1  leo /*
     46  1.1  leo  * Check partitions for consistency :
     47  1.1  leo  *	GEM vs BGM
     48  1.1  leo  *	Start sector > 2
     49  1.1  leo  *	End sector < secperunit
     50  1.1  leo  *	other partition overlap
     51  1.1  leo  *	auxiliary root overlap
     52  1.1  leo  *	Number of partitions in root/auxiliary root
     53  1.1  leo  */
     54  1.1  leo int
     55  1.1  leo ahdi_checklabel (ptable)
     56  1.1  leo 	struct ahdi_ptable	*ptable;
     57  1.1  leo {
     58  1.1  leo 	int		i, j, rcount, acount;
     59  1.1  leo 	u_int32_t	i_end, j_end;
     60  1.1  leo 
     61  1.1  leo 	ahdi_errp1 = -1;
     62  1.1  leo 	ahdi_errp2 = -1;
     63  1.1  leo 
     64  1.1  leo 	if (ptable->nparts < 1 || ptable->nparts > MAXPARTITIONS)
     65  1.1  leo 		return (-2);
     66  1.1  leo 
     67  1.1  leo 	rcount = 0;
     68  1.1  leo 	acount = 0;
     69  1.1  leo 
     70  1.1  leo 	for (i = 0; i < ptable->nparts; i++) {
     71  1.1  leo 
     72  1.1  leo 		/* GEM vs BGM */
     73  1.1  leo 		if (ptable->parts[i].size > 32768) {
     74  1.1  leo 			if (AHDI_MKPID (ptable->parts[i].id[0],
     75  1.1  leo 			    ptable->parts[i].id[1], ptable->parts[i].id[2])
     76  1.1  leo 			    == AHDI_PID_GEM) {
     77  1.1  leo 				ahdi_errp1 = i;
     78  1.1  leo 				return (-3);
     79  1.1  leo 			}
     80  1.1  leo 		} else {
     81  1.1  leo 			if (AHDI_MKPID (ptable->parts[i].id[0],
     82  1.1  leo 			    ptable->parts[i].id[1], ptable->parts[i].id[2])
     83  1.1  leo 			    == AHDI_PID_BGM) {
     84  1.1  leo 				ahdi_errp1 = i;
     85  1.1  leo 				return (-3);
     86  1.1  leo 			}
     87  1.1  leo 		}
     88  1.1  leo 
     89  1.1  leo 		/* Need 2 free sectors at start for root and bad sector list */
     90  1.1  leo 		if (ptable->parts[i].start < 2) {
     91  1.1  leo 			ahdi_errp1 = i;
     92  1.1  leo 			return (-4);
     93  1.1  leo 		}
     94  1.1  leo 
     95  1.1  leo 		i_end = ptable->parts[i].start + ptable->parts[i].size - 1;
     96  1.1  leo 
     97  1.1  leo 		/* Check partition does not extend past end of disk */
     98  1.2  jdc 		if (i_end >= ptable->secperunit) {
     99  1.1  leo 			ahdi_errp1 = i;
    100  1.1  leo 			return (-5);
    101  1.1  leo 		}
    102  1.1  leo 
    103  1.1  leo 		for (j = i + 1; j < ptable->nparts; j++) {
    104  1.1  leo 			/* Check for overlap with other partitions */
    105  1.1  leo 			j_end = ptable->parts[j].start + ptable->parts[j].size
    106  1.1  leo 			    - 1;
    107  1.1  leo 			if ((ptable->parts[j].start >= ptable->parts[i].start
    108  1.1  leo 			    && ptable->parts[j].start <= i_end) ||
    109  1.1  leo 			    (j_end >= ptable->parts[i].start &&
    110  1.1  leo 			     j_end <= i_end)) {
    111  1.1  leo 				ahdi_errp1 = i;
    112  1.1  leo 				ahdi_errp2 = j;
    113  1.1  leo 				return (-6);
    114  1.1  leo 			}
    115  1.1  leo 			/* Check number of partitions in auxiliary root */
    116  1.1  leo 			if (ptable->parts[i].root &&
    117  1.1  leo 			    ptable->parts[i].root == ptable->parts[j].root) {
    118  1.1  leo 				ahdi_errp1 = i;
    119  1.1  leo 				ahdi_errp2 = j;
    120  1.1  leo 				return (-9);
    121  1.1  leo 			}
    122  1.1  leo 		}
    123  1.1  leo 
    124  1.1  leo 		for (j = i; j < ptable->nparts; j++)
    125  1.1  leo 			/* Check for overlap with auxiliary root(s) */
    126  1.1  leo 			if (ptable->parts[j].root >= ptable->parts[i].start &&
    127  1.1  leo 			    ptable->parts[j].root <= i_end) {
    128  1.1  leo 				ahdi_errp1 = i;
    129  1.1  leo 				return (-7);
    130  1.1  leo 			}
    131  1.1  leo 
    132  1.1  leo 		/* Count partitions in root/auxiliary roots */
    133  1.1  leo 		if (ptable->parts[i].root)
    134  1.1  leo 			acount ++;
    135  1.1  leo 		else
    136  1.1  leo 			rcount ++;
    137  1.1  leo 
    138  1.1  leo 	}
    139  1.1  leo 	/* Check number of partitions in root sector */
    140  1.1  leo 	if (acount)
    141  1.1  leo 		rcount++;
    142  1.1  leo 	if (rcount > 4)
    143  1.1  leo 		return (-8);
    144  1.1  leo 	else
    145  1.1  leo 		return (1);
    146  1.1  leo }
